ALEXANDRIA, Va., March 24 -- United States Patent no. 12,587,535, issued on March 24, was assigned to ExtraHop Networks Inc. (Seattle).

"Detecting abnormal data access based on data similarity" was invented by Xue Jun Wu (Seattle), Swagat Dasgupta (Kirkland, Wash.) and Matthew Alexander Schurr (Mercer Island, Wash.).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Embodiments are directed monitoring network traffic using network monitoring computers. Activity associated with a document in a network may be determined based on the network traffic.
